Trump Administration Sabotages Science and Taxpayers With Corrupt Takeover of NSF Building
(Washington, DC) – Last night, Politico reported that the Trump administration is preparing to move the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) into the headquarters of the National Science Foundation (NSF) –potentially dislocating the entire staff of NSF.
According to the American Federation of Government Employees (AFGE), the HUD takeover of the NSF building involves plans for several luxury upgrades for HUD Secretary Scott Turner, including:
- A dedicated executive suite for the HUD Secretary on the 19th floor.
- The construction of an executive dining room.
- Reserved parking spaces for the Secretary’s 5 cars.
- Exclusive use of one elevator for the Secretary.
- A space dedicated to hosting the Secretary’s executive assistants on the 18th floor.
- A potential gym for the HUD Secretary and his family.
Ranking Member Zoe Lofgren (CA-18) made the following statement:
“The Trump administration’s egregious, corrupt, and disgraceful abuse of power continues, this time by kicking dedicated scientists out of their building so HUD Secretary Turner can have a penthouse dining suite. For an administration so obsessed with claiming that it's cutting spending, how can Trump justify the tax-payer dollars it will take to meet Turner’s ridiculous demands, like a gym for his exclusive use or parking spaces for his five cars? Instead of investing in our future, the Trump Administration is investing in private perks for Secretary Turner. Where will NSF staff go? What is the Trump administration’s plan? Once again, science loses, the American taxpayer loses, and our competitors, like China, win.”
